Rushing Towards Victory

An article from “The Telegraph” titled “Muslim Brotherhood claims victory in Egyptian

presidential elections” discusses the different reactions of the Egyptian people about what

happening when the elections end and what the campaigns of the two candidates did after the

first results has been shown on the television until publishing the final results and knowing who

is the president of Egypt.

"The campaign of Dr Mohammed Mursi announced... his victory as president of the Arab

Republic of Egypt according to the results reported by its representatives and counting records

from all polling stations," the organisation said in a statement, adding Mr Morsi had won 52

percent of the vote.

But a Shafiq campaign official said their figures showed Shafiq, who served as prime

minister to deposed dictator Hosni Mubarak, leading in the count.

"We reject it completely," Mahmud Barakeh, said of the Brotherhood's claim. "We are

astonished by this bizarre behaviour which amounts to a hijacking of the election results."

“The jubilation at Mr Morsi's headquarters was overshadowed however by a looming

showdown between the Brotherhood and the ruling military, which issued a new constitutional

document shortly after polls closed on Sunday.

The document issued by the Supreme Council of the Armed Forces grants the body

legislative powers after a top court on Thursday ordered the dissolution of the Islamist-

dominated parliament.

Mohamed 25

The document also gives SCAF veto power over the text of a new permanent

constitution, and states that no new parliamentary vote will be held until after a permanent

constitution is approved.

The document was issued after a Thursday ruling from the constitutional court, which

found a third of the parliament's members had been elected illegally, effectively ordering the

dissolution of the body.

The declaration confirmed the military was retaking the legislative power it handed the

body in January after its election.”

The Muslim Brotherhood and revolutionary youth movements denounced the declaration

as a "coup" and the Freedom and Justice Party said it rejected any bid by the military to retake

legislative power.

The new political uncertainty comes after an electoral race that polarised the nation,

dividing those who fear a return to the old regime under Shafiq from others who want to keep

religion out of politics.

"The new president will inherit a struggling economy, deteriorating security and the

challenge of uniting a nation divided by the 18-day uprising that toppled Mubarak in February

2011.”

Poverty in Egypt

There are many factors that affected the Egyptian community for several years, and these

factors affect Egypt economically, socially, and globally. Although there is a solution for each

problem, the Egyptians were not enthusiastic for solving their problems. One of these problems

is poverty. Poverty is the most crucial problem that faces the Egyptian community that need to

be solved in an effective way.

Each country around the world faces many problems that affect them economically and

socially. But for the sake of the country to be a developed one, Egyptians should try to eradicate

these problems. Poverty in Egypt has increased in the last two decades. Can you imagine that

there is a person on earth who earns one and a half pound every day? What is shocking is that

statistics showed that there are 35 million people only in Egypt who do! I think that the reason

for the whole thing is that the last regime. Because it helped in widening the gap between the

rich and the poor by doing several things like rising prices of the common products that people

need such as rice, sugar, and bread. But what is the benefit for them? I think that the benefit is to

steal people’s money in order to make their projects and gain a lot of money to do what they

want. For example, Mubarak’s food had to come from France in a private plane and there are

Mohamed 45

40% of the Egyptians who eats from 2-3 times a day the same meal. The percentage of the poor

in Upper Egypt is lower than in the cities like Cairo. May be because people of Upper Egypt can

find the job that satisfies their lives like being farmers and have their own land to work at. Also,

the prices are lower than in the city. Unemployment is another problem that leads to poverty and

if the governments try to solve it, it will lead to eradicate poverty in Egypt. Many youngsters

could not find jobs that help them to live like any one of their ages around the world. They were

sitting at homes without hopes and ambition because they cannot live a normal life, and they

cannot marry because of the conditions they live under. They were hanging out with their friends

and just talking about their dreams as they are impossible. For example, I know someone who is

a petroleum engineering graduate and no one will imagine that this engineer is a waiter in a

restaurant. Is this his fault that he cannot find the job he wants? I think that the last regime did

not steal the lives of many people; it stole the spirit for doing a small job for achieving the big

dream and this small job must be in the field that people graduate at.

There are many solutions that should be considered, and if I were the president of Egypt,

I will make the priority for these solutions to solve poverty. I think that the Egyptian revolution

was the first step to solve all the problems that face the community because freedom and social

justice were just dreams that are impossible to achieve. But in the day 25th of January 2011,

many people go out in the streets and call for their rights peacefully and the revolution succeeds.

Now Egypt has an elected president who should consider these problems, should listen carefully

for Egyptians, should give a suitable solution to raise the economy, and help Egypt to become

one of the best countries in the world. To solve poverty, the president should increase job

opportunities by doing some decisions like if a foreign company wants to invest in Egypt; they

should employee a high percentage of their employers of Egyptians, and this percentage should

Mohamed 46

be increased by the development of the economic situation. This is one of many solutions that

can eradicate poverty in Egypt in an effective way.

The good thing in the Egyptians is that if they are in the right positions, they will work

hard to be the best. This advantage should be considered by the current president and the

following ones and know that Egyptians, nowadays, know their rights and will not allow anyone

to steal their freedom and now they live in a democratic country even they do not know about

democracy well. And government should be accountable and let people know the money that

spent and the money gained too in order to win the trust of people. So honesty is the best want to

keep people together and co-operate to develop their country, and people should try their best to

narrow the gap between the rich and the poor in order to eradicate poverty because this step is

the first one in developing the economy consequently developing our country.
